Since their max drawdown on 150K is $4500, so the money you can use is $4500. You need to make $9000, which is 200% profit. Also it is trailing drawdown, which is much tougher than simply giving you $4500 to trade. Because if you trade on $4500, as you make profit, your risk of blowing up is reduced. But for trailing drawdown, your risk remain the same no matter how much profit you make.
Yes. And no. With trailing DD you cannot compound your profits (increase your size as eq goes up - eventually you'll blow), which is a disadvantage. With NO trailing DD - your risk of blowing up is reduced ONLY if you do not compound your profits, which leaves your eq curve linear instead of exponential = the same profit result as with trailing DD above with lesser and lesser risk of ruin The best is NO trailing DD AND compounding your profits - you keep constant risk of ruin, BUT benefit from exponential growth, which is infinitely better with time. As with TST: the DD trails up to your initial equity, and then stays forever there. BUT - you still cannot compound without increasing the risk of ruin unless your daily loss limit is also increased. These are subtleties which one needs to consider very carefully when choosing Prop- and designing your risk management strategy.
